Harnessing the Power of Hydroxycitric Acid (HCA)
Hydroxycitric acid HCA is a natural substance found in various tropical fruits such as mangosteen. It has gained popularity as a potential dietary supplement due to its ability to influence metabolism.
Studies have demonstrated HCA may support reducing calorie intake. It is considered to operate by blocking citrate lyase, thus limiting fat synthesis.
However, it's crucial to understand more further investigation is warranted to fully understand the long-term effects of HCA.

Exploring the Science Behind Garcinia Cambogia's Effects
Garcinia cambogia exhibits gained considerable popularity in recent months as a potential weight loss aid. This tropical fruit, originating to Southeast Asia, contains a ingredient called hydroxycitric acid (HCA), which is presumed to play a role in managing appetite and boosting metabolism.
Studies exploring the effects of HCA on weight loss have produced inconsistent results. Some studies have indicated that HCA may lead modest reductions in body weight, while others revealed no appreciable effects.
